Description
Willow House is a spacious and well built 4 bedroom detached home, originally constructed by a local builder for his own occupation, resulting in larger than average rooms and a notably solid feel throughout. The ground floor offers a practical layout with a generous kitchen, separate dining room, utility room, cloakroom and internal access to the single garage, while upstairs features four good sized bedrooms including a master with en-suite and a family bathroom.
Positioned halfway up a gentle hillside, the property enjoys open views from the rear living spaces down into the valley, with the elevated setting creating a bright, open outlook and a sense of privacy despite being in the heart of the village. Outside, the well landscaped garden includes established flower beds, ornamental trees and lawned areas enclosed by timber fencing, while the front of the property provides off-road parking and access to the garage. The home is within easy walking distance of the local shop, playing field and Tatworth Primary School, and is well placed for enjoying the surrounding countryside, Chard Reservoir, and a range of popular destinations including Lyme Regis, Charmouth, Bridport and several well-regarded pubs and farm shops

The property is located in a pleasant residential area on the outskirts of South Chard, a popular and busy village with a good range of local amenities including general store/post office, excellent primary school, social club, pub and Church. There is a bus service to Chard which is just 3 miles away and caters for most everyday needs and also to Taunton some 16 miles to the North. Lyme Regis to the South is just 10 miles away.
